  1. Quincy Carter. LaVonya Quintelle "Quincy" Carter (born October 13, 1977) is an American former professional football player who was a quarterback in the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the Georgia Bulldogs and was selected in the second round of the 2001 NFL draft.

    Quincy Carter rose to stardom at Southwest DeKalb High School in Decatur, Georgia, just outside Atlanta. The three-sport star shined in all phases, but football was his calling — Carter led the Panthers to the 4A State Championship and was named Georgia's Gatorade Player of the Year.
